Benefits of Indoor Cat Doors
Before we dive into the installation process, let's have a look at the benefits of indoor cat doors:
• Convenience: Indoor cat doors allow your cat to come and go as they please, eliminating the requirement for constant door opening and closing.• Energy Efficiency: By minimizing the variety of times you require to open and close traditional doors, indoor cat doors can assist decrease heat loss and gain, making your home more energy-efficient.• Safety: Indoor cat doors minimize the danger of unintentional escape or injury, as your cat can safely enter and exit the house without the threat of being caught or struck by a closing door.• Reduced Stress: Indoor cat doors can help decrease tension and stress and anxiety in both felines and owners, as they get rid of the requirement for continuous door tracking and create a more tranquil living environment.

Installation Process
Setting up an indoor cat door is a fairly simple process that needs some fundamental DIY abilities and tools. Here's a detailed guide to help you start:
Tools Needed:
Drill and bitsScrewdriver and screwsMeasuring tapeLevelPencil and markerSafety glasses and a dust mask (optional)
Step 1: Choose the Perfect Location
When selecting the best location for your indoor cat door, think about the list below aspects:
Traffic: Choose a place with very little foot traffic to prevent mishaps and tension.Availability: Ensure the place is quickly available for your cat, and preferably near a food source or litter box.Environment: Avoid locations with extreme temperatures, moisture, or drafts.
Action 2: Measure and Mark the Door
Measure the width of your cat door and mark the center point on the wall or door frame. Utilize a level to make sure the mark is directly, and a pencil to draw a line along the length of the door.
Step 3: Cut Out the Door
Utilize a drill and bits to cut out a hole for the cat door, following the manufacturer's directions for shapes and size.
Step 4: Install the Door Frame
Set up the door frame, guaranteeing it is level and protect. Usage screws to connect the frame to the wall or door frame.
Step 5: Add the Door Panel
Attach the door panel to the frame, following the maker's guidelines for assembly and installation.
Step 6: Test the Door
Test the door to guarantee it is functioning appropriately, and make any necessary adjustments to the positioning or stress.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: How do I select the ideal size cat door for my pet?
A: Measure your cat's width and height to figure out the perfect door size. Seek advice from the manufacturer or a pet expert for assistance.
Q: How do I avoid drafts and moisture from entering through the cat door?
A: Install a weatherproof seal or threshold to lessen drafts and wetness. Frequently clean and keep the door to avoid damage.
Q: Can I set up an indoor cat door in a load-bearing wall?
A: It is advised to avoid setting up cat doors in bearing walls, as this can compromise the structural stability of your home. Speak with a professional if you're not sure.
Q: How do I keep other animals or insects from going into through the cat door?
A: Install a safe and secure locking mechanism or use a magnetic closure system to avoid undesirable entry. Consider adding a screen or mesh to keep pests and pests out.
